1997 Alfa Romeo 156 vs. 1997 Hyundai Lantra
To start off, both 1997 Alfa Romeo 156 and 1997 Hyundai Lantra were released in the same year (1997).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,387 cc (5 cylinders), 1997 Alfa Romeo 156 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1997 Alfa Romeo 156 (134 HP @ 4200 RPM) has 46 more horse power than 1997 Hyundai Lantra. (88 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1997 Alfa Romeo 156 should accelerate faster than 1997 Hyundai Lantra.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1997 Alfa Romeo 156 weights approximately 255 kg more than 1997 Hyundai Lantra.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1997 Alfa Romeo 156 (304 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 176 more torque (in Nm) than 1997 Hyundai Lantra. (128 Nm @ 4300 RPM). This means 1997 Alfa Romeo 156 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1997 Hyundai Lantra.
Compare all specifications:
1997 Alfa Romeo 156 | 1997 Hyundai Lantra |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Hyundai |
Model | 156 | Lantra |
Year Released | 1997 | 1997 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2387 cc | 1495 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 5 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 134 HP | 88 HP |
Engine RPM | 4200 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 304 Nm | 128 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 4300 RPM |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1350 kg | 1095 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4440 mm | 4460 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1710 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1460 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2600 mm | 2560 mm |
